Paintless damage removal (PDR) is a technique made use of to deal with dents and dings on an auto without requiring to repaint the surface area. Service technicians make use of specialized tools to delicately push and massage therapy the damage out from the cars and truck's body.
It's an excellent option for problems that happen from small crashes, buying cart accidents, or hail storm tornados. If a dent lies on a level or somewhat bent surface and hasn't badly extended the steel, PDR is often ideal. It's most effective on more recent vehicles since they have paint surfaces that are less most likely to fracture or flake throughout the repair process.
